Guys and Gals Golf Tournament

On Feb. 19, an initially damp, foggy and slightly overcast morning greeted 33 teams of one man and one woman of varying golfing skills at the par 54 Turtle Lake Golf Course. The sun worked hard to break through the overcast, and by 9 a.m. the morning was clear and temps were warming. There was no wind, and the course dried up quickly, making for a good playing conditions.

Overall, the golf course was in good shape with greens, fairways, and tee boxes in very playable condition. The 33 teams competed for best net scores (gross score minus handicap), plus four circle holes (shots within a 5-foot radius rewarded), and two closest to the pin challenges. With the excellent play ing conditions, all teams scored well with 30 of the 33 teams net at or below par, plus there were four circle hole winners, and 57 birdies recorded.

Closest to the pin for the men was Tom Owens and Gene Archambault, and for the women it was Kyung Ju and Grace Choi. Low net score for the round was James Farr and Bert Thompson at 11 under par. Fujio Norihiro and Keiko Sekino, Tom Owens and Alison Kim, and Scott Tuchfarber and Pam Krug tied for second lowest at 10 under par. Bob and Janice Turner were third lowest at 7 under.

Tournament statistics: Overall average gross score for all 33 teams was 60.4 strokes or slightly over six strokes above par. Average net scores for all teams was 49.3 strokes or just short of five strokes under par. Gross scores were better by two strokes than last month’s tournament.

A flight winners (handicaps of 0-9): The Turners, first place; Won and Jane Song, second; Pat Paternoster and Nancy Smith, and Bob Barnum and Kyung Ju, third.

B flight winners (handicaps of 10-12): Norihiro and Sekino, and Owens and Kim, first place: Dave LaCascia and Liz Meripol, John Kolthoff and Elizabeth Butterfield, Seon and Sang Kim, and Mike Mayfield and Nancy Tye, second.

C flight winners (handicaps of 13-18): Farr and Thompson, first place; Tuchfarber and Krug, second; Paul Shellenberger and Lynn Baidack, and Ron Jackson and Dale Quinn, third; Mark Tal and Clara Suh, and John Rudosky and Jane Kors, fourth.
